Appointment of Integrity Commissioner

The City of Regina and City of Saskatoon (the Cities) invite applications from individuals to act as an Integrity Commissioner for both Cities on an as needed basis for up to a 4 year term (the term may be for two years with an option to extend the contract for two additional one year terms). The services required include providing advice and education to Council members and accepting and investigating complaints of the two Citys respective code of ethics bylaws that apply to City Council members including making recommendations on sanctions where violations are found.

The intent of this posting is to seek submissions from interested individuals with past experience in providing legal advice on ethical matters and conducting investigations. Only those candidates who are deemed to be qualified by the Cities will be contacted. The successful candidates will be considered to be independent contractors and will be asked to enter into separate contracts with each City for the services required.

Description of Duties and Services

The duties of the Integrity Commissioner and the services that will be required will include the following:

Advisory:

  • To provide written and oral advice to individual Council members on questions of compliance with each Citys respective code of ethics bylaws;

The advisory function above may also be extended in the future to providing:

  • written and oral advice to individual Council members on questions of compliance with the conflict of interest provisions of The Cities Act and any other bylaws policies or Acts governing the behaviour of Council members;
  • providing the whole of Council with specific and general opinions and advice on bylaws policies protocols or Acts regulating the conduct of Council members and issues of compliance;
  • providing input to the City Administration on additional rules and restrictions that may be added to each Citys code of ethics bylaws from time to time.

Investigative:

  • To receive and assess all written complaints to determine if there is jurisdiction to investigate and sufficient grounds for an investigation of a violation of each Citys code of ethics bylaw by a Council member;
  • To investigate complaints received and conduct inquiries as to violations of each Citys code of ethics bylaw;
  • To determine and report to the Executive Committee and Council as to whether a member has violated the respective Citys code of ethics bylaw;
  • To make recommendations on whether to censure a Council member impose sanctions or corrective actions where there is a violation of the respective code of ethics bylaw.

Educational:

  • To publish an annual report on the office of the Integrity Commissioner including examples in general terms of advice rendered and complaints received and disposed of;
  • To provide general educational sessions to Council members on the substance and application of each Citys code of ethics bylaw where requested by Council or the City Administration;
  • To assist each respective City Solicitor and City Clerk in the development of policies and processes for the work of the Integrity Commissioner including recommended amendments to each code of ethics bylaw.
